It isn’t uncommon today to see men and women in elected and appointed positions. But, only a few generations ago, seeing women in office was unheard. Women weren’t even allowed the right to vote in America. All that changed this week in 1920, with the passing of the Nineteenth Amendment, which gave all women the right to vote.

A school lunch will cost a nickel more this coming year in the Hannibal Central School District.
The five cent increase was approved by the Board of Education during a discussion of whether to raise the price by ten cents instead.
This weekend’s heavy rains have forced the state to close the locks along the Oswego Canal.
The locks in Phoenix, Fulton, Minetto and Oswego will stay closed until water levels subside.
